In our GK-2 studio, we prioritize small group batches, usually capped at 8 to 12 participants. This ensures I can provide hands-on adjustments for every student, making sure your postures are safe and effective regardless of your current flexibility level.
Yoga is not just about the poses. My practice, Aatmspand, is built on the belief that movement should be a dialogue between your body and soul. In our sessions, we weave together the foundational techniques of Hatha and Ashtanga with specific breathing patterns to help you find balance.
What to expect when you join:
- Small Group Focus: By limiting our batch sizes, I ensure that everyone gets personal attention. This is especially helpful if you are working on specific goals like back pain relief or improving your breathwork.
- Breath and Movement: We dedicate significant time to Pranayama and meditation. Techniques like Nadi Shodhana help calm the nervous system, while Yoga Nidra is there for when you need that deep, restorative rest.
- A Community Space: Our studio is designed to feel like home. With elements like our Buddha mural and warm lighting, it provides a break from the city chaos. We have a diverse community of students, from local residents to visitors from Germany and New York, all learning together.
